ok my ex-husband went to court a few months ago to have child support lowered. he was denied and has to go back in april with proof of income. the first time he went to court i couldn't show up so i sent a letter to the judge to be put on record. i didn't get into trouble or anything because of it. now i got a piece of paper in the mail saying my ex has a pre-trial conference and has to bring in papers to show proof of income. do i have to appear even though i wasn't served by sherriff?
 
Depends on the rules of service of your unknown State.

In many States you can be legally served by mail, in others you can't.

Doesn't sound like this is a summons though in any event - just sounds like a notice to let you know the status of your case.
